GRD Development of Prototype
Corium Solutions Ltd has demonstrated proof of concept for a low toxicity anti-fungal treatment known as Micro-Fresh which is effective in preventing moulds developing on plastered or plasterboard walls in humid environments. The inhalation of the spores from moulds is known to be harmful and can lead to asthma and other serious pulmonary conditions such as aspergilliosis. The purpose of this project is to demonstrate the effectiveness of Micro-Fresh treatments on representative brick & plaster and block & plasterboard walls inoculated with Aspergillus fumigatus and Aspergillus niger in a large environmental chamber at 24 deg C and 95% humidity. Such conditions are known to promote the growth of Aspergillus sp.

GRD Proof of Market
The UK is one of the few countries that permit healthcare workers not only to wear their uniforms to and from work but also to launder them at home; however this could be considered to be a source of infection. Whilst NHS guidelines recommend high temperature washing or disinfecting under controlled conditions it is difficult to carry this out in most domestic washing machines. Corium has developed an anti-pathogen treatment for leather products that has been trialled to treat healthcare uniforms and has the potential to inhibit pathogen development in textiles on a long term basis using the low temperature washing cycle of a domestic washer in the range 30-40 deg C. The purpose of the grant application is to analyse the market potential for this innovation

GRD Proof of Concept
Corium Solutions Ltd has developed a low toxicity anti-fungal treatment which it is believed will be effective in preventing moulds developing on plastered or plasterboard walls in humid environments. The inhalation of the spores from moulds is known to be harmful and lead to asthma and other serious pulmonary conditions such as aspergilliosis. The purpose of this proof of concept project is to conduct trials for formulation development and carry out a market review.
